The Daily Brief of British military intelligence reported on it November 18 attack on the oil terminal in the port of Novorossiysknear which a significant part of the Russian Black Sea Fleet is located, reports the BBC Russian Service.
According to the British, it was there, in Novorossiysk, the Russian command transferred the submarines from the Crimealater in October the Ukrainians attacked the port of Sevastopol. The new attack, now against the port of Novorossiysk, shows that even there the Russian fleet is no longer safe. Even more later the explosion of the Kerch bridge in October, the supply of the Russian group to Crimea is mainly carried out by sea, from Novorossiysk.
The details of the November 18 incident are not entirely clear, but any demonstration of the Ukrainian army’s ability to strike Novorossiysk will seriously complicate the life of the command of the Russian fleet, which has already lost its positions in the Black Sea, summarizes the British army intelligence.
Recall that small kayak-shaped boats equipped with cameras, tracking devices and jet engines were used to attack the Russian Black Sea Fleet on October 29 in the annexed port of Sevastopol in the Crimea.
More than a month ago, Russian sources released photos of the unmanned kamikaze boat, a strange aircraft painted in military gray and equipped with a white contraption and what appeared to be a normal jet engine
Russian sources said an object resembling an unmanned surface vehicle of some kind washed up on the Sevastopol shore this afternoon.
